Assets Export Problem !!

New Here ,
Feb 19, 2017 Feb 19, 2017

I have a problem with my #Illustrator CC 2017. There is a 1px transparent margin is added to the output PNG, as I have set up a complex document with various art-boards this is a serious problem for my workflow.

The hint by adobe guide doesn't help, as my document was already on 72dpi. I guess it is a bug.

So I just made this shape in Illustrator, exported it using the export panel, and then opened the PNG inside of Photoshop to check it. If you see the gap between the top of the canvas and the stroke, it appears there is roughly a 2px gap there. Is that what you're referring to in your case? If I check that gap, there is some pixel data there, semi-transparent pixels on the edge for blending/anti-aliasing.
